Southland Transit, Inc. is one of California’s most experienced community transit companies having operated demand response and fixed route services for over 20 years. Our services have been provided under contract with multiple Los Angeles County cities, the County of Los Angeles, and numerous transit agencies. Through these experiences we have developed a high level of expertise in the delivery of community transit services. We offer the experience of a national operator with the accessibility of a local operator.

Autonomous Demand-Response Scheduling and Dynamic Route Optimization

In the highly fragmented Los Angeles transit market, manual scheduling is prone to human error and inefficiency. For a mid-size operator, the ability to dynamically adjust routes based on real-time traffic data and passenger demand is critical for maintaining contract SLAs. Traditional scheduling systems often lack the agility to handle last-minute cancellations or surges, leading to empty seats or missed pickups. AI agents can bridge this gap, ensuring optimal vehicle utilization while minimizing operational costs, which is essential for retaining municipal contracts where cost-per-trip is a primary performance metric.

Up to 22% improvement in vehicle utilizationJournal of Public Transportation Analytics
The agent ingests real-time GPS data, booking requests from the existing WordPress-integrated portal, and regional traffic feeds. It continuously re-calculates the most efficient route paths, pushing updates directly to driver tablets. By autonomously managing the dispatch queue, the agent reduces the need for manual intervention, allowing dispatchers to focus on complex service exceptions rather than routine scheduling tasks.

Predictive Vehicle Maintenance and Fleet Health Management

For a regional transit operator, unexpected vehicle downtime is the largest threat to service reliability. Mid-size fleets often rely on reactive maintenance, which is costly and disruptive to fixed-route schedules. By shifting to a predictive model, Southland Transit can identify mechanical issues before they lead to service failures. This not only extends the operational lifespan of the fleet but also reduces emergency repair costs and improves passenger safety, which is a non-negotiable priority in California’s stringent transit regulatory environment.

15-20% decrease in unscheduled maintenance costsFleet Maintenance Industry Benchmarks
The agent analyzes telematics data from the fleet, identifying patterns that precede mechanical failure. It cross-references these patterns with maintenance logs stored in the company’s internal systems. When a potential issue is detected, the agent automatically triggers a maintenance request and schedules the vehicle for service during off-peak hours, ensuring minimal disruption to the daily transit schedule.
